Locati is proud to present property from the estate of Albert and Pearl Nipon (Philadelphia, PA), the estate of Jack Bershad (Philadelphia, PA), and from the collection of Mr and Mrs Arnold Rifkin (Wilkes-Barre, PA). Featured are Fratelli Cacchione sterling, a George I Burl Walnut Chest on Chest Secretary, a Chinese Porcelain Oxblood Vase, an oil on panel by George Cochran Lambdin, a Jydsk Mobelvaerk Danish Modern Teak Sofa, a Renaissance Revival Clock retailed by J. E. Caldwell, a monumental oil on canvas by Robert Lee MacCameron, a Victorian period Trompe L'oeil Cast Iron Safe, a group of China Trade, a Dyrlund Danish Modern Rosewood Dining Table, jewelry, fine art, furniture from the 18th through 20th centuries, and Asian art.

Partial Service, Crown Staffordshire Hunting Scene
A partial porcelain dinner service in the "Hunting Scene" pattern. Comprising: four 8 1/2" soup bowls, six 5" demitasse saucers, six 2 1/2" tall demitasse cups, four 4 1/4" tall coffee cups, three 5 3/4" saucers, four 2 1/2" teacups, two 3" teacups, one 6 1/4" saucer, One 8" , 4 1/2" gravy boat and stand, one 7" x 4 1/2" server, one 10" x 7 1/2" open server, one 4" creamer, one 4" covered sugar, one 7 3/4" coffeepot, and one 3" creamer.
Dimensions:Please see the description for measurements.
Provenance:From the Estate of Albert and Pearl Nipon
Condition: The coffeepot has a repair to the spout, three cups and one soup bowl are cracked.
